Foam roller

The bumps knead the contours of the body, gently stretching soft tissue (muscle and fascia) in multiple directions. The action erodes trigger points, helping restore flexibility, and brings quick relief to common types of muscular pain. Through simple techniques, one can control the amount of pressure the bumps apply to the body. The bumps are closely spaced, so several of them simultaneously come in contact with the body during exercise. With a slight shift of the body, one can reduce the area of contact, which increases pressure and provides greater relief.
